  • Vaykira: Roundtable on the Purpose of Korbanot
    Mar 17 2026

    This week we switch things up with a roundtable format. Benny Attar, Nava Gelb, and Adin Halbfinger join to discuss the real purpose of korbanot, working through four classic positions: obedience to divine command, moral repentance and confronting mortality, the Rambam's cultural accommodation theory, and the kabbalistic view of spiritual repair.
